Aquarium Stands are Practical Pieces of Furniture

Aquarium stands can be beautiful pieces of furniture as well as serve the useful purpose of holding up your fish tank.

A fish tank stand can be as simple as a plain metal stand or an elaborate case that serves as a focal piece in your living room.

When shopping for aquarium stands, it’s most important to make sure it will hold your aquarium. Most tanks and stands are sold together so you know they fit, but if you are buying piecemeal you will need to know the length and width of your tank so you can match it to a stand – or the gallons (i.e a 30 gallon long or 25 gallon etc…) as most fish tank stands are sold to those specs as well. Of course if you are building a stand yourself, take care to make sure that it is sturdy enough to hold the weight of your tank when it is full.

You won’t have to worry about this with a manufactured stand as they are made to hold the weight of the size tank they are built for.

Additionally, you will want to make sure that it will fit in the spot that you have chosen for your tank so it is a good idea to measure the space and bring along a tape measure when shopping for aquarium stands so you can insure the piece you choose will actually fit.

Also, take in to consideration the furniture you already have in the room – if you are putting it in a living room with all oak furniture you will probably want to pick a light wood stand but if you have a sleek modern look in the room a black stand or even one of the new chrome stands might look nice.

Finally when thinking about buying aquarium stands consider all the equipment and accessories that goes with your tank. Some fish tank stands are built like cabinets and can hide all the pumps and filters that go with your tank. You can use the extra cabinet area to store fish food, nets, test kits and accessories and have all your “fish” stuff in 1 spot!
